2. Make Patriotic Crafts

Another fun activity for kids is making patriotic crafts. You can make a flag out of popsicle sticks, create a red, white, and blue windsock, or even make a patriotic wreath for your front door. These crafts are not only fun but also a great way to decorate your home for the 4th of July.

3. Host a Backyard BBQ

A backyard BBQ is a great way to celebrate the 4th of July with family and friends. You can grill burgers and hot dogs, serve watermelon, and even make homemade ice cream. You can also set up some fun outdoor games like cornhole or volleyball to keep everyone entertained.

4. Watch a Fireworks Show

Watching a fireworks show is a classic 4th of July tradition. You can find local fireworks shows in your area or even set off your own fireworks (if legal in your area). Watching the fireworks with your kids can be a magical experience that they will remember for years to come.

Celebrating Independence Day

Independence Day, also known as the Fourth of July, is a patriotic holiday celebrated annually in the United States. It commemorates the adoption of the Declaration of Independence on July 4, 1776, which declared the United States as a free and independent country. This holiday is often celebrated with parades, fireworks, and family gatherings.
